The Blues and Blackhawks combined for seven goals in the first period, with Chicago holding a 5-2 lead at the end, but St. Louis tied it up with three straight goals in the second. Ten damn goals in two periods. There weren’t any goals in the third, but Blues winger Vladimir Tarasenko wristed in the winner in 3-on-3 overtime for the 6-5 win.
